Job Summary
Responsible for the management and coordination of the 2nd Shift Welding and Fabrication department (3:00 PM – 11:30 PM). This role ensures the manufacturing of stainless‑steel food packaging equipment is consistent with our client goals to improve facility performance, throughput, and product standards. The supervisor provides leadership to a team of TIG welders working primarily with 16ga up to 1” 303 and 304 stainless steels.
Plan, organize, and direct 2nd shift welding and maintenance operations which ensure the most effective return on assets.
Ensure all assemblies meet strict tolerances for food‑grade welding and grinding. Assure attainment of production schedules while ensuring product standards exceed our customers' expectations.
Initiate plans and processes which minimize manufacturing costs through effective utilization of manpower, equipment, facilities, materials, and capital.
Establish group and individual accountabilities throughout assigned departments for problem solving and cost reduction. Encourage use of new techniques and focus on fact‑based problem solving.
Oversee the assembly of components to strict tolerances using TIG welding on 303 and 304 stainless. Maintain cosmetics and finish requirements. Assist team members as needed to meet daily production goals.
Assure that employees are fairly treated, all policies are effectively administered, and that employee grievances are addressed in a timely fashion.
Continually improve safety record by addressing both physical safety issues and employee safety attitudes. Maintain and improve housekeeping in all welding areas.
Implement manufacturing strategies and action plans to ensure that the facility supports CV‑TEK's strategic initiatives.
Maintain individual skills keeping up to date with latest production and production management concepts.
